The DNA (deoxyribonucleic acid) is a double stranded molecule that has been found to be responsible for heredity of traits. It is characterized by 3 main components:

  • A phosphate group
  • A deoxyribose sugar
  • Purine and or pyrimidine bases

The purine bases include Adenine and Guanine while the pyrimidine bases include Thymine and Cytosine.

The DNA differs from RNA in that the RNA (ribonucleic acid) is single stranded, contains ribose sugar and instead of Thymine base, it contains Uracil.
